The Open Source Security Foundation (OpenSSF) have announced Siren, “a collaborative effort to aggregate and disseminate threat intelligence specific to open source projects”. The initiative comes in the wake of the XZ Utils compromise where it became clear that open source projects needed better ways to disseminate and receive relevant threat intelligence.
